Claxton, Georgia
Claxton - Mrs. Thelma Morris, 91, died early Tuesday morning at the Claxton Nursing Home. The Evans County native had lived in Claxton all of her life. She was a homemaker and a member of the First Christian Church in Glennville. She was preceded in death by her husband, E.N. Morris and a...
